Due to a comment about us “dancing in all the corners” of the world by my brother Danny, I thought I’d publicly keep track of where we’ve danced or cued and taught over the years!! It’s starting to look like we’ve been a few places since we started teaching in 1996, huh?
As of 13 July, 2015 we had officially driven our RV in all states except Hawaii (including the District of Columbia!).
As an on the side - as of 26 Oct 2020, we've parked our RV overnight in 116 Walmarts in 31 states!! What a statistic!!
On our trip to Africa in Apr/May 2018, we not only danced a couple of dances at every lodge, but we also taught basic cha! Had a blast!
In December 2019, we danced on the continent of Antarctica. Once again I sang "I Wanna Hippopotamus for Christmas" while George cued basic cha figures & we danced with Batcheller's and Rich & Georgianne. It was a beautiful sunny day & the beach was mostly bare of snow. The penguins were watching! That meant we had now danced on all 7 continents!
In December 2016, we danced on Cape Horn! I sang "I Wanna Hippopotamus for Christmas" while George cued and we danced with Hibner's & Batcheller's!!! In 55 knot winds! That was way way cool!
